
[2015年之前]java开发
文章平均质量分 81
徐长亮
大数据工程师
展开
-
【java】java面向对象
2.类的定义1.1 引用类型变量2.2 成员方法3.3 JVM的内存结构4.4 方法的重载5.5 this关键字6.6 null关键字7.7 构造方法8.2 类的继承9.1 方法的重写Overwrite10.2 重写和重载的区别3.3 访问控制1.1 import语句2.2 protected和默认访问控制4.4 static和final1.1 static成员变量2.2 static方法3.3 static方法的意义4.4 final类5.5 final方法6.6原创 2015-03-14 22:19:15 · 998 阅读 · 0 评论 -
【web基础】CSS选择器
1.1元素选择器以html标签的名称p/h1{}input元素中,文本框,单选框等都一个样式1.2类选择器,不同的标签细分;css文件中: .s1{..}html页面中: <元素 class=”s1”>缺点:文本框的使用难题原创 2015-03-30 13:25:09 · 862 阅读 · 0 评论 -
【javaSE】Java泛型机制
泛型是JavaSE5 引入的特性,泛型的本质是参数化类型。应用场景:在类,接口和方法的定义过程中,所操作的数据类型被传入的参数指定。例如在ArrayList类的定义中,<E>中的E为泛型参数,在创建对象是可以将类型作为参数传递,此时定义中的所有E将被替换为传入的参数;原创 2015-03-11 10:13:26 · 1172 阅读 · 1 评论 -
【javaSE】Collection框架及List集合
JDK提供集合框架Collection和mapl 接口Collection包括两个子接口:接口List和接口Setl List接口包括两个实现类:ArrayList,LinkedList类l Set接口包括两个实现类:HashSet,TreeSet类map接口包括两个实现类:HashMap和TreeMap类原创 2015-03-09 16:34:05 · 900 阅读 · 0 评论 -
【javaSE】基本类型包装类
JDK 5发布之前,使用包装类对象进行运算时,需要较为繁琐的“拆箱”和“装箱‘操作装箱Interger i=integer.valueOf(100);Interger j=integer.valueOf(200);拆箱+装箱:Integer k=Interger.valueOf(i.intValue() + j.intValue());JDK 5增加了自动拆箱和装箱功能,列入Interger i=100;Interger j=200;Interger k=i+j;原创 2015-03-05 17:05:30 · 1074 阅读 · 0 评论 -
【javaSE】Date和Calendar类
2.1 Date类及常用方法java.util.Date类用于封装日期和时间信息。目前Date类的大多数用于进行时间分量计算的方法已经被Calendar取代。无参的构造方法,构造的Date对象封装当前的日期和时间信息Date date=new Date();Date类已经重新了toString对象getTime()方法:获取1970年1月1日距今的毫秒数,例如long ti原创 2015-03-05 16:34:10 · 944 阅读 · 0 评论 -
【javaSE】HashSet和HashMap
HashSet的实现通过Hash表实现的: 添加对象到HashSet的过程: 元素——取出元素的hashcode---通过Hash算法——索引到相应的存储空间; HashSet的contains方法实现: 参数对象的hashcode值找到相应的存储空间,然后和该空间的对象进行equal比较;原创 2015-03-14 12:00:00 · 1166 阅读 · 0 评论 -
【javaSE】java异常处理机制
1.1 Exception类java异常结构中定义有throwable类,Exception和Error是其派生的两个子类。其中Exception表示由于非法情况导致的异常,Error表示java运行时候环境出现的错误。异常处理的目的就是当异常发生时候妥善的终止程序,避免灾难性后果的发生,具体的操作通常包括:l 通知:向用户通知异常对的发生l 恢复:保存重要的数据,关闭文件,回原创 2015-03-02 14:50:26 · 1102 阅读 · 0 评论 -
【DAO】计费系统数据库设计简单文档
数据库的设计文档数据库的设计文档,需要建表的sql语句。1) account 账务账户id number(9) PK 账务账户IDlogin_name varchar2(20)not null用户自服务用户名login_passwd varchar2(8) not null用户自服务密码status char(1) not null 0:开通 1:原创 2015-03-03 14:07:22 · 3709 阅读 · 0 评论 -
【JDBC】java PreparedStatement操作oracle数据库
import java.sql.Connection;import java.sql.ResultSet;import java.sql.SQLException;//import java.sql.Statement;import java.sql.PreparedStatement;public class lx02{ public static void main(S原创 2014-06-27 13:29:27 · 4258 阅读 · 0 评论 -
【JDBC】java 操作oracle 建表,更新记录
1. 建立表的类import java.sql.Connection;import java.sql.ResultSet;import java.sql.SQLException;import java.sql.Statement;import java.sql.PreparedStatement;public class lx01{ public static vo原创 2014-06-27 17:32:39 · 6592 阅读 · 0 评论 -
【JSP】JSP与oracle数据库交互案例
本案例为咖啡销售情况录入查询系统一、数据输入系统:1. 设计输入信息页面代码如下: 咖啡管理系统——录入系统 欢迎来到录入系统 咖啡名称:供应商ID:商品价格:销售量:总量: 2. 设计处理or原创 2014-06-30 13:29:34 · 6627 阅读 · 1 评论 -
【J2SE】java多线程学习笔记
Runnable接口的使用://执行New Thread(runnable class).start()执行 runnable calss的run方法。publicclass helloimplements Runnable { /** * @param args */ private Stringname; //构原创 2014-08-31 16:18:19 · 770 阅读 · 0 评论 -
【翻译】jdbc developers guide and reference:第一章
;jdbc thin driver通过在java sockets头中实现sql*net 来直接连接数据库;jdbc thin驱动需要数据库服务器启动TNS监听TPC/IP socket; jdbc oci driver jdbc oci驱动是java类型2驱动,需要安装oracle client,即只支持oracle平台;oci驱动支持全部的oracle net adapters适配器,包括 IPC,管道命名,TCP/IP,IPX/SPX; jdbc oci驱动是用java和C混合写的,使用被动翻译 2015-04-03 17:42:15 · 879 阅读 · 0 评论